
The province will also continue to maintain products that have previously met the standards and strive to upgrade approximately 50% of its products to 4 stars or higher.
Regarding the development of business entities, the province strives for at least 50% of entities with products achieving 3 stars or higher to be cooperatives and small and medium-sized enterprises; 50% of entities to be managed by women, ethnic minorities, or people with disabilities; and 70% of entities to establish stable linked raw material areas.
To effectively implement this orientation, the province pays special attention to developing OCOP products in conjunction with rural tourism , preserving traditional craft village culture, and promoting trade through modern, online sales channels.
The Department of Agriculture and Environment will take the lead in coordinating with relevant units to organize the evaluation and classification of products at the provincial level. The People's Committees at the commune level will directly guide, receive applications, and conduct preliminary evaluations at the grassroots level.
